Dubbo和Zookeeper不是SpringCloud的东西,放在这里只是为了方便复习;1、下载安装Zookeeper和Dubbo1.1下载安装教程下载安装教程windows环境下安装zookeeper教程详解(单机版)1.2启动页面1.2.1zkServer.xmdzookeeper服务端1.2.2zkCli.cmdzookeeper客户端1.3.3运行double-adminjava-jardubbo-admin-0.0.1-SNAPSHOT.jar访问localhost:70012、SpringBoot集成dubbo+zookeeper2.1模块项目建立2.1.1主项目2.1.1.1p
Dubbo和Zookeeper不是SpringCloud的东西,放在这里只是为了方便复习;1、下载安装Zookeeper和Dubbo1.1下载安装教程下载安装教程windows环境下安装zookeeper教程详解(单机版)1.2启动页面1.2.1zkServer.xmdzookeeper服务端1.2.2zkCli.cmdzookeeper客户端1.3.3运行double-adminjava-jardubbo-admin-0.0.1-SNAPSHOT.jar访问localhost:70012、SpringBoot集成dubbo+zookeeper2.1模块项目建立2.1.1主项目2.1.1.1p
目录一、前言二、代码演示1、配置文件2、pom依赖 3、创建微服务三、请求测试1、微服务请求转发2、第三方请求转发一、前言微服务中经常用到gateway作为网关,它有什么作用,怎么使用?SpringCloudGateway的目标提供统一的路由方式且基于Filter链的方式提供了网关基本的功能, 例如:安全、监控、指标和限流 。SpringCloudGateway的通信框架使用的是Netty。特点:1、动态路由:能够匹配任何请求属性2、可以对路由指定Predicate(断言)和Filter(过滤器): predicate,可以理解为匹配条件;filter,可以理解为拦截器。3、集成
目录一、前言二、代码演示1、配置文件2、pom依赖 3、创建微服务三、请求测试1、微服务请求转发2、第三方请求转发一、前言微服务中经常用到gateway作为网关,它有什么作用,怎么使用?SpringCloudGateway的目标提供统一的路由方式且基于Filter链的方式提供了网关基本的功能, 例如:安全、监控、指标和限流 。SpringCloudGateway的通信框架使用的是Netty。特点:1、动态路由:能够匹配任何请求属性2、可以对路由指定Predicate(断言)和Filter(过滤器): predicate,可以理解为匹配条件;filter,可以理解为拦截器。3、集成
文章目录1.复现问题2.分析问题3.解决问题4.该错误的其他解决方法1.复现问题今天在JSONObject.parse(json)这个方法时,却报出如下错误:com.alibaba.fastjson.JSONException:syntaxerror,positionat0,nameusername atcom.alibaba.fastjson.parser.DefaultJSONParser.parseObject(DefaultJSONParser.java:615) atcom.alibaba.fastjson.parser.DefaultJSONParser.parse(Default
文章目录1.复现问题2.分析问题3.解决问题4.该错误的其他解决方法1.复现问题今天在JSONObject.parse(json)这个方法时,却报出如下错误:com.alibaba.fastjson.JSONException:syntaxerror,positionat0,nameusername atcom.alibaba.fastjson.parser.DefaultJSONParser.parseObject(DefaultJSONParser.java:615) atcom.alibaba.fastjson.parser.DefaultJSONParser.parse(Default
Eureka采用CS(Client/Server,客户端/服务器)架构,它包括以下两大组件:EurekaServer:Eureka服务注册中心,主要用于提供服务注册功能。当微服务启动时,会将自己的服务注册到EurekaServer。EurekaServer维护了一个可用服务列表,存储了所有注册到EurekaServer的可用服务的信息,这些可用服务可以在EurekaServer的管理界面中直观看到。EurekaClient:Eureka客户端,通常指的是微服务系统中各个微服务,主要用于和 EurekaServer进行交互。在微服务应用启动后,EurekaClient会向EurekaServer
Eureka采用CS(Client/Server,客户端/服务器)架构,它包括以下两大组件:EurekaServer:Eureka服务注册中心,主要用于提供服务注册功能。当微服务启动时,会将自己的服务注册到EurekaServer。EurekaServer维护了一个可用服务列表,存储了所有注册到EurekaServer的可用服务的信息,这些可用服务可以在EurekaServer的管理界面中直观看到。EurekaClient:Eureka客户端,通常指的是微服务系统中各个微服务,主要用于和 EurekaServer进行交互。在微服务应用启动后,EurekaClient会向EurekaServer
目录1.JWT简介2.登录鉴权流程3.springcloudgateway简单使用4.创建Token5.实现登录鉴权6.刷新令牌1.JWT简介JWT:全称是JSONWebToken,是token的一种实现方法。通俗地说,JWT的本质就是一个字符串,它是将用户信息保存到一个Json字符串中,然后进行编码后得到一个JWTtoken,并且这个JWTtoken带有签名信息,接收后可以校验是否被篡改,所以可以用于在各方之间安全地将信息作为Json对象传输。JWT结构:JWT由3部分组成:标头(Header)、有效载荷(Payload)和签名(Signature)。在传输的时候,会将JWT的3部分分别进行
目录1.JWT简介2.登录鉴权流程3.springcloudgateway简单使用4.创建Token5.实现登录鉴权6.刷新令牌1.JWT简介JWT:全称是JSONWebToken,是token的一种实现方法。通俗地说,JWT的本质就是一个字符串,它是将用户信息保存到一个Json字符串中,然后进行编码后得到一个JWTtoken,并且这个JWTtoken带有签名信息,接收后可以校验是否被篡改,所以可以用于在各方之间安全地将信息作为Json对象传输。JWT结构:JWT由3部分组成:标头(Header)、有效载荷(Payload)和签名(Signature)。在传输的时候,会将JWT的3部分分别进行